Cross-channel measurement control and configuration
Abstract:
The present invention introduces a method and a system for base station cross-channel measurement control and configuration. A centralized unit (CU) (301, 601) of a base station configures (304, 305) at least two distributed units (DU) (302, 303, 602, 604) with DU sounding signaling transmission objects and DU cross-link measurement objects. The first DU (302) transmits (306) a sounding signal through an air interface (308) which the second DU (303) measures (307). The second DU (303) reports (309) this to the CU (301). Then the second DU (303) transmits (311) a sounding signal through an air interface (312) which the first DU (302) measures (310). The first DU (302) reports (313) this to the CU (301). Beam-forming can be applied as well. Also neighboring operators can be found by inter-frequency measurements of the sounding signals or Synchronization Signals. The CU (301, 601) can control the DUs (302, 303, 602, 604) with appropriate TDD switching patterns based on the found cross-link interference levels.
